Hi Kilnkreations,I remember there used to be a Bennett's Glass sign by the roundhouse at the end of Armley Road (Wortley/Holbeck border.) It was white with light blue lettering and 'B' logo. I don't know if that is where the factory was, or whether it was just an advertisement. My brother says he went to school with one of their clan, in the 70s, and reckons they lived near Stainburn, between Otley and Harrogate (so they must have been quite well off.) I don't know what happened to the business, but the sign was there up til the mid 80s, at a guess. That's as much as I know, I'm afraid.Cheers,Si. Hi Si,Yes I did go to school with Mark Bennett, his dad ran Bennet's Glass and it was indeed where you say, down the side of the round house.Mark and two older brothers went to the same school, unfortunately Mark got expelled!! so not seen him in years.If I remember correctly it was not ornate/coloured glass though, he told me they did security glass, the type used at tellers in banks and building societies that could withstand close range gun fire!!Hope this is of some help??

I had a temp job at Bennetts 30 years ago. They made Anti Bandit glass which was sandwiches of glass and plastic, often up to an inch thick.

I am the Son of one of the directors of Bennetts Glass -Dales Bennett.Unfortunately My father passed away at the time the company was sold to Alcan about 30 years ago.I am happy to help anyone with their family tree should they want to get in touch
